The Drive down 89-Alt (89A) from Flagstaff through the Coconino National Forest is just breathtaking, it is one of the most amazing and naturally beautiful places in the world. The red striped mountains push up through rows of pine forest and look simply amazing against the bright blue sky.&lt;/div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;a href="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_J0wJAOhI3Cw/Sca2YUX--pI/AAAAAAAAAJQ/r70z5fq90ms/s1600-h/DSC_0220.JPG"&gt;&lt;img id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5316136939059870354" style="FLOAT: left; MARGIN: 0px 10px 10px 0px; WIDTH: 200px; CURSOR: hand; HEIGHT: 134px" alt="" src="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_J0wJAOhI3Cw/Sca2YUX--pI/AAAAAAAAAJQ/r70z5fq90ms/s200/DSC_0220.JPG" border="0"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;div&gt;We hiked up Cathedral Rock, which is home to one of the four mythical energy "Vortexes" in the area. These Vortexes are points in the earth where the planets energy are supposedly more concentrated and spring form the earth. Sedona is home to four such areas and the spots have been revered for hundreds of years, first by the Native American (Apache, Hopi, and Navajoe) people and now by the thousands of new age types and nature lovers.&lt;/div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;div&gt;The hike up Cathedral rock is pretty strenuous, it varies from level trails to almost 70 degree angle climbing to reach the highest point. The view from the top is just amazing, we stayed up there for over an hour, met some interesting locals and took in the 360 degree views of Sedona. The pictures and video just can not even come close to being there, its defintily worth a stop if you are in Arizona.&lt;/div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;a href="http://1.bp.blogspot.com/_J0wJAOhI3Cw/Sca2Xu2ewDI/AAAAAAAAAJI/M_J9Q3h6QP8/s1600-h/DSC_0272.JPG"&gt;&lt;img id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5316136928987234354" style="FLOAT: left; MARGIN: 0px 10px 10px 0px; WIDTH: 200px; CURSOR: hand; HEIGHT: 134px" alt="" src="http://1.bp.blogspot.com/_J0wJAOhI3Cw/Sca2Xu2ewDI/AAAAAAAAAJI/M_J9Q3h6QP8/s200/DSC_0272.JPG" border="0"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;object width="300" height="200"&gt;&lt;param name="movie" value="http://www.youtube.com/v/E0COprVGX2M&amp;color1=0xb1b1b1&amp;color2=0xcfcfcf&amp;hl=en&amp;feature=player_embedded&amp;fs=1"&gt;&lt;/param&gt;&lt;param name="allowFullScreen" value="true"&gt;&lt;/param&gt;&lt;embed src="http://www.youtube.com/v/E0COprVGX2M&amp;color1=0xb1b1b1&amp;color2=0xcfcfcf&amp;hl=en&amp;feature=player_embedded&amp;fs=1" type="application/x-shockwave-flash" allowfullscreen="true" width="300" height="200"&gt;&lt;/embed&gt;&lt;/object&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/6276474369547669688-3609925575839617715?l=vacationroad.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://vacationroad.blogspot.com/feeds/3609925575839617715/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=6276474369547669688&amp;postID=3609925575839617715'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/6276474369547669688/posts/default/3609925575839617715'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/6276474369547669688/posts/default/3609925575839617715'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://vacationroad.blogspot.com/2009/03/sedona-arizona.html' title='Sedona Arizona'/><author><name>Wesley Warren</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/15633549745766039314</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='24' src='http://www.freelancedesigners.com/blog.jpg'/></author><media:thumbnail xmlns:media='http://search.yahoo.com/mrss/' url='http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_J0wJAOhI3Cw/Sca2YUX--pI/AAAAAAAAAJQ/r70z5fq90ms/s72-c/DSC_0220.JPG' height='72' width='72'/><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-6276474369547669688.post-4732836571377933646</id><published>2009-03-22T14:34: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2009-03-22T14:51:10.656-07:00</updated><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='meteor crater arizona'/><title type='text'>Meteor Crater Arizona</title><content type='html'>&lt;a href="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_J0wJAOhI3Cw/Scav7VzyWcI/AAAAAAAAAJA/vlWpgGreHjA/s1600-h/DSC_0172.JPG"&gt;&lt;img id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5316129844158945730" style="FLOAT: left; MARGIN: 0px 10px 10px 0px; WIDTH: 320px; CURSOR: hand; HEIGHT: 214px" alt="" src="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_J0wJAOhI3Cw/Scav7VzyWcI/AAAAAAAAAJA/vlWpgGreHjA/s320/DSC_0172.JPG" border="0"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;div&gt;Stop by and see the worlds first identified meteor crater just south of Holbrook, Arizona. The UFO museum itself is fairly interesting, it has a lot of newspaper clippings, official US Government Documents about the protocal for dealing with EBE's (extreterestrial biological entities) and several other cool exhibits. Unless you are really interested in a lot of reading the avidavids of witnesses and several other documents related to the UFO crash that was reported in the Roswell newspaper in July of 1947, you probably wont want to spend too much time there, its very interesting but not real exciting and kids would probably get bored pretty quick - although a few of the children that were there were actually spending quite a bit of time reading the extensive exhibits from cover ups, to surgically removed implants! There are also some pretty neat photos of real UFO's and Hoaxes (by real I mean the photos have been examined and deemed authentic photos of objects that could not be identified, what they actually are is anyones guess...).&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Lodging/Hotels in Roswell, NM&lt;/strong&gt;&lt;br /&gt;In Roswell we stayed at the Days Inn on Central Ave just a mile or so past the UFO museum. The caverns and the National Park are incredibly beautiful. The mountins and sheer rock cliffs along the drive to the caverns enterance offer plenty of breathtaking photo opportunites. The Cavern itself is just plain awesome. We just caught the last self-guided tour at 2PM (so get there early) and the hike through the upper cavern is about an hour, deep down into the earth and is filled with countless amazing natural rock formations. The trail is paved, but it does get pretty steep (almost all downhill) and wet - you definitly need a flashlight as the cave has a lot of internal lighting but much of the path is very dark and the flashlight came in handy.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;a href="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_J0wJAOhI3Cw/Sbcv6PsKEpI/AAAAAAAAAIY/uSmswVWB26o/s1600-h/large_formation.JPG"&gt;&lt;img id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5311766963197448850" style="FLOAT: left; MARGIN: 0px 10px 10px 0px; WIDTH: 134px; CURSOR: hand; HEIGHT: 200px" alt="" src="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_J0wJAOhI3Cw/Sbcv6PsKEpI/AAAAAAAAAIY/uSmswVWB26o/s200/large_formation.JPG" border="0"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;p&gt;After the hour hike in through the cavern you reach the elevators and a underground giftshop and bathrooms. From there you can tour another hour long path through the "grat room" which has so many incredible formations and variety of stalagmites and stalagties, as well as other bizzare formations, plenty of great photo opportunities but you will need to use your cameras night-shot setting and use a tripod or find a steady place to allow for the long exposures required. Believe me its well worth it! we got some AMAZING photos in the great room which are on our &lt;a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/36124396@N04/sets/72157615089056598/" target="new"&gt;carlsbad caverns&lt;/a&gt; flickr page.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/6276474369547669688-4791268648164281711?l=vacationroad.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://vacationroad.blogspot.com/feeds/4791268648164281711/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=6276474369547669688&amp;postID=4791268648164281711'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/6276474369547669688/posts/default/4791268648164281711'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/6276474369547669688/posts/default/4791268648164281711'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://vacationroad.blogspot.com/2009/03/aliens-in-roswell-new-mexico.html' title='Aliens! in Roswell, New Mexico'/><author><name>Wesley Warren</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/15633549745766039314</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='24' src='http://www.freelancedesigners.com/blog.jpg'/></author><media:thumbnail xmlns:media='http://search.yahoo.com/mrss/' url='http://3.bp.blogspot.com/_J0wJAOhI3Cw/SbcpeRwsSHI/AAAAAAAAAIQ/i5d---e5QNQ/s72-c/wes_ceiling_cropped.jpg' height='72' width='72'/><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-6276474369547669688.post-8366381783910921360</id><published>2009-03-09T11:06:00.001-07:00</published><updated>2009-03-09T11:13:51.679-07:00</updated><title type='text'>Carlsbad, New Mexico Hotels</title><content type='html'>We stayed at the Carlsbad Inn and got a great deal, only $55 and the rooms were a little older than the Best Western down the road ($100/night) but the staff was very friendly and helpful, and the rooms have microwaves and refridgerators as well as free HBO. Hence, it is not a wonder why more than 30 million foreigners visit here per year.&lt;br /&gt;Some of the must-see destinations in Paris are:&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Eiffel Tower : Built on the Champ de Mars near the Seine River, this iron tower is unquestionably the greatest of all attractions in Paris, and in deed, stands as the city’s icon. Inaugurated on March 31, 1889, it is the tallest of its kind in Paris, and was once the tallest in the world until the erection of Chrysler Building in 1930. Rising up to a height of about 985 feet, Eiffel Tower’s top can be seen anywhere from Paris. As per the records of the Paris Office of Tourism, Eiffel Tower alone drew about six million tourists to Paris in 2002.&lt;br /&gt;Louvre : Situated in the heart of Paris, Louvre is the one of the world’s largest museums, sprawling over an area of about 60,000 square foot expansive building. On display are more than 350000 pieces of art, covering Egyptian sculptures, 18th century furniture and books, engravings, paintings, and drawings.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Most popular among the collections in the museum are the paintings of Leonardo Da Vinci, such as Monolisa. Apart from its amazing collections, Louvre, once served as a royal residence, is also much famed for its mind blowing architectural style. The entry to the museum was earlier restricted to the royal visitors. But, after the French Revolution, the museum was opened to the public.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Notre Dame Cathedral : This Gothic cathedral would be the most famous of all cathedrals in the world. Located in the heart of the city on a small island, namely, Ile de la Cite, Notre Dame Cathedral serves as the seat of the Archbishop of Paris. The cathedral is regarded as a fine example of French Gothic architecture. Built during the 14th century, its interiors, sculptures, and gargoyles were destroyed during the revolution. Later, the cathedral was renovated by Eugene Emmanuel Viollet-le-Duc, a Persian architect.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Arc de Triomphe: One of the most visited attractions in the country, Arc de Triomphe is credited to the largest traffic roundabout in the world. Commissioned by Napoleon in 1806 in order to commemorate his military successes as well as the bravery of his armies, Arc de Triomphe was however completed in 1836, many years after the passing away of the emperor. The sides, front and back of the Arc De Triomphe are graced with beautiful sculptures as well as intricate designs. A specialty of this roundabout is that it is the meeting point of about 12 avenues.&lt;br /&gt;Concorde Place : The largest public square in Paris, Concorde Place is situated between Champs Elysees and the Tuileries garden. Earlier known as Place Louis XV, the square’s focal point is a huge Egyptian obelisk beautified with hieroglyphics. The obelisk has been brought from the temple at Luxor, and was French king Charles X in 1829 by Mohammed Ali, the then Viceroy of Egypt.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Highlights in Paris also cover Avenue Champs-Elysees, a vibrant area packed with a plenty of shops and restaurants; Latin Quarter, boasting of some of the finest Roman as well as medieval monuments in the city; Rodin Museum, which exhibits the works of the renowned French sculptor, Auguste Rodin; D’Orsay Museum; and St.Chapelle and Conciergerie.&lt;br /&gt;With these scores of attractions, Paris is a wonderful vacation whose memories last for a lifetime. If ever in a rut and one wants to get away, you can hang with friends from an exotic country and try some foods from a different region around the world and let your imagination allow you to be kid like and relax as it takes you there..&lt;/div&gt;&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/6276474369547669688-7428817207887824594?l=vacationroad.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://vacationroad.blogspot.com/feeds/7428817207887824594/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=6276474369547669688&amp;postID=7428817207887824594'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/6276474369547669688/posts/default/7428817207887824594'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/6276474369547669688/posts/default/7428817207887824594'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://vacationroad.blogspot.com/2008/08/journey-that-brings-out-kid-in-you.html' title='The Journey That Brings Out the Kid In You'/><author><name>Soleilwriter</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/01368503880724635895</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='31' height='32' src='http://2.bp.blogspot.com/-7LQkzpIl6ac/Tx0Y9ulYw4I/AAAAAAAAAyA/YgGC6NQD4bc/s220/SDC110445w.jpg'/></author><media:thumbnail xmlns:media='http://search.yahoo.com/mrss/' url='http://3.bp.blogspot.com/_W91QH2PZE3o/SL_-NAuRmcI/AAAAAAAAACA/4-97Bnm5HD8/s72-c/j0438811.jpg' height='72' width='72'/><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-6276474369547669688.post-5391706431437134066</id><published>2008-07-29T12:21: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2008-10-02T12:57:21.750-07:00</updated><title type='text'>Helen the Home of a Lovely Getaway</title><content type='html'>&lt;a href="http://bp0.blogger.com/_W91QH2PZE3o/SI9uhJz_eAI/AAAAAAAAAAY/1Yp-6RlYxA8/s1600-h/hg.jpg"&gt;&lt;img id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5228519208249161730" style="FLOAT: right; MARGIN: 0px 0px 10px 10px; CURSOR: hand" alt="" src="http://bp0.blogger.com/_W91QH2PZE3o/SI9uhJz_eAI/AAAAAAAAAAY/1Yp-6RlYxA8/s320/hg.jpg" border="0"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;div&gt;Helen, Georgia is located in Northeast Georgia in the Blue Ridge Mountains along the Chattahoochee River. It is a re-creation of a German Alpine Village that has Cobblestone Alleys and old-world towers. This village has rich history that is linked to the Cherokee Indians and early settlers who arrived in 1800 to mine for gold and cut timber for the lumber industry. This quaint mountain community has been around for well over thirty-five years. Its Bavarian feel makes you feel like you standing in Germany at that given moment. Our first stop was to get a bite to eat where we enjoyed a relaxing German meal at the Troll’s Tavern. For my meal I had the Knockwurst platter which consists of two beef sausages accompanied by sauerkraut and served with a tasty German style potato salad. I was told that the imported beer and wine was a must try. As I savored my meal, I joyfully watched many others engage in river tubing along side the Tavern. After leaving the tavern my friends and I decided to partake in a horse-drawn carriage ride. Molly (our horse’s name) took us around the village. After our carriage ride we decided to walk off our meal with a little shopping. There are more than 200 specialty and import shops that include everything from Artesian crafts to cheeses, fine chocolates, cakes, cuckoo clocks, precious stones and gems to mood rings and candle making. We tried to make to the Anna Ruby Falls but they were already closed. We had to finally bring our adventure to an end by sharing a funnel cake while sitting by the water fountains. We truly loved this Alpine Village located right here in Georgia. We look forward to coming back when we have more time and enjoy the other activities such as: horseback riding, golf, canoeing, fishing, mountain biking, hiking and more. This trip was perfect for a quick getaway since were just an hour and half away. The locals told us to be sure to comeback during one of the many festivals the town host such as: Winefest, Volksmarch, Oktoberfest and Christmas parades, Fourth of July fireworks, and Bavarian Nights of Summer. The best time to visit is from mid-September through October, Helen hosts the longest Oktoberfest in the South. Alpenfest offers loads of fun for tourist during the Holiday season from Thanksgiving through December. &lt;/div&gt;&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/6276474369547669688-5391706431437134066?l=vacationroad.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://vacationroad.blogspot.com/feeds/5391706431437134066/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=6276474369547669688&amp;postID=5391706431437134066' title='1 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/6276474369547669688/posts/default/5391706431437134066'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/6276474369547669688/posts/default/5391706431437134066'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://vacationroad.blogspot.com/2008/07/helen-home-of-romantic-getaway.html' title='Helen the Home of a Lovely Getaway'/><author><name>Soleilwriter</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/01368503880724635895</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='31' height='32' src='http://2.bp.blogspot.com/-7LQkzpIl6ac/Tx0Y9ulYw4I/AAAAAAAAAyA/YgGC6NQD4bc/s220/SDC110445w.jpg'/></author><media:thumbnail xmlns:media='http://search.yahoo.com/mrss/' url='http://bp0.blogger.com/_W91QH2PZE3o/SI9uhJz_eAI/AAAAAAAAAAY/1Yp-6RlYxA8/s72-c/hg.jpg' height='72' width='72'/><thr:total>1</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-6276474369547669688.post-7277852845002505923</id><published>2008-05-08T10:25: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2008-05-08T10:37:43.255-07:00</updated><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='mountain'/><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='beach'/><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='resort'/><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='Vacation'/><title type='text'>Welcome to VacationRoad.com Blog page.</title><content type='html'>&lt;img src="http://www.vacationroad.com/images2/vrheader3.jpg"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Vacation Road will be the guide to your resort, leisure sports and exciting vacation.
